Summary:Charlene Jones, the Director of Human Resources for a large urban transit organization, knew there was a big problem. She had recently received the training outcome data for the past three years confirming that the recent classes of transit operator trainees failed the training (or withdrew) at a rate of 31.7%. This rate was three times the industry average (about 10%). With the cost to train estimated at approximately USD 14,000 per trainee, and about 250 trainees participating in training annually, the cost of training failures had reached significant levels (approximately USD 1.11M dollars annually). Although Ms. Jones recognized that she had a problem and would need to advise her manager, she was unsure what to do. The purpose of this case is to assist Ms. Jones in diagnosing and solving the high training failure rate for transit operator trainees in her organization by investigating the role of trainee characteristics and training program details.
